From the News-Press:
Yousel Lopez Rivera, 21, has been charged with attempted first-degree murder of a police officer.
David Brener, who is representing Rivera, filed a motion to block the video’s release to prevent adverse pre-trial publicity that could make seating a jury difficult.
The video shows Officer David Wagoner stopping a black Cadillac with an expired tag on Santa Barbara Boulevard around 12:30 a.m. April 16. After talking briefly with the driver, he walks around to the other side of the vehicle to talk to the passenger, at which point a gun can be seen poking out the window and firing three shots into Wagoner from a few inches away.
Wagoner sticks his arms out before falling back and rolling onto the sidewalk. He lifts himself to his knees and fires seven shots at the fleeing vehicle.
“I’m hit Cape. I need a medic. Black Cadillac heading north. White male, purple shorts,” he tells dispatch.
Three witnesses leave their vehicles to check on Wagoner, asking him if he’s OK and where he is hit. “I’m not sure,” he says. “I don’t want to look at this point.”
Two of the bullets lodged in his bulletproof vest while a third slipped beneath the vest and tore through his abdomen.
